She was still very pale, however, and the dark lines under her eyes seemed to speak of a sleepless night.

I fancied that she welcomed me a little shyly.

She dropped her veil almost at once, and she did not ask me to sit down.
"I hope that you have some news this morning of your uncle, Miss Delora ?" I asked.
She shook her head.
"I have not heard--anything of importance," she answered.
"I am sorry," I said.

"I am afraid that you must be getting very anxious." She bent over the button of her glove.
"Yes," she admitted.

"I am very anxious! I am very anxious indeed.
